METHOD OF OPERATING A TELECOMMUNICATIONS NETWORK

    Abstract: A method of operating a telecommunications network (100), said telecommunications network being accessible to a User Equipment (UE) (102) and comprising a cellular telecommunications network (104-2) and a fixed-access telecommunications network (104-1), the method comprising the steps of: providing a set of user plane functions for processing user traffic for the UE, said set comprising at least two user plane functions; providing a combined user plane function (210) for processing user traffic for the UE according to the set of user plane functions; following establishing a network connection between the UE and the cellular telecommunications network via the fixed-access telecommunications network (510), identifying inefficient routing of user traffic associated with the UE (520), said inefficient routing comprising routing user traffic to at least the set of user plane functions; in response to identifying inefficient routing, re-routing user traffic associated with the UE to the combined user plane function so as to process the user traffic at the combined user plane function instead of at the set of user plane functions (530).

    METHOD OF CONTROLLING AUTONOMOUS VEHICLES

    Abstract: A computer-implemented method of controlling Autonomous Vehicles (AVs) for delivering a payload (120) to an intended delivery location (130-2) comprising the steps of: identifying a first AV (110-1) for retrieving a payload from a first location (130-1); determining a second location (140-1) to which the first AV is capable of travelling with the payload from the first location; instructing the first AV to retrieve the payload from the first location and to deliver the payload to the second location; communicating a wireless communication (160) requesting assistance from another AV to deliver the payload from the second location, wherein the wireless communication is in the form of a system information message; in response to the wireless communication, identifying a second AV (110-2) for retrieving the payload from the second location; and instructing the second AV to retrieve the payload from the second location and to deliver the payload to the intended delivery location (140-3).

    IMS REGISTRATION MANAGEMENT

    Abstract: In a LTE network user devices can access voice application service via Voice over LTE (VoLTE) and Voice over WiFi (VoWiFi). To detect faults in the data link associated with an evolved packet data gateway for providing access by the user device to the LTE network from a non-trusted network which will affect VoWiFi capability, a packet data gateway monitors the status of ePDG and if a fault is detected, the user device is notified that it should connect to voice services via VoLTE.

    MAINTENANCE OF LOCAL/TRACKING AREA MAPPINGS

    Abstract: A mobile terminal (11) transmits data to a base station (1) of a first network relating to neighbour base stations (13) of a second network. The base station (1) transmits the neighbour data to a network management processor (12) controlling the mobile communications system, which maintains a mapping data store (27) associating the base station with the neighbour base stations. The mapping facilitates a dual attachment process which allows connection of terminals to both networks, thus facilitating transfer of connection between networks.
